Schools were forced to close and households and businesses in more than 50 London postcodes were left without water or with low water pressure this morning after a power supply failure at a local plant.

At 9.30am Thames Water said that an issue at its Ashford and Hampton water treatment works was affecting parts of west and southwest London, forcing several schools to shut for the day.

People living in parts of Putney, Wembley, Twickenham, Richmond, Southfields, Hampton, Uxbridge and White City have all been affected, the water company said.

However, people living in SW11, incorporating much of Battersea and Clapham, also reported problems.
